Quick and Efficient Techniques

Efficiency is the name of the game when the mercury climbs, and the cooking method should reflect that. Many of the best recipes rely on a single skillet or a large pot of boiling water, reducing the amount of cleanup required at the end of a long day. Searing protein like chicken or shrimp in a hot pan provides deep flavor quickly, while a rapid sauté of vegetables keeps them crisp and colorful.

Pasta water is a secret weapon in these scenarios. Starchy and hot, it acts as the perfect emulsifier, helping to bind oil and ingredients together into a glossy sauce without the need for heavy creams. Learning to reserve and incorporate this water is a fundamental skill that transforms a simple pasta toss into a cohesive, restaurant-quality dish.

The Power of Acid and Herbs

Brightness is crucial, and that almost always comes from an acid component. Lemon juice is a popular choice, as it complements the sweetness of tomatoes and the saltiness of cheese perfectly. Vinegars, such as balsamic or champagne vinegar, can also add a sophisticated layer of complexity that lingers pleasantly on the palate.

Fresh herbs are the aromatics that define these dishes. Basil, mint, and parsley are not merely garnishes; they are the soul of the meal. Adding them at the end of the cooking process preserves their volatile oils, ensuring that the dish smells as good as it tastes. The volatile aromas of herbs provide an immediate sense of freshness that cooked spices often cannot match in hot weather.

Texture and Crunch

To keep the experience engaging, you must incorporate a contrast in textures. A soft bed of pasta is wonderfully comforting, but it needs a crunchy element to prevent the dish from feeling monotonous. Toasted nuts, such as pine nuts or almonds, provide a rich crunch and a dose of healthy fats that satisfy without weighing you down.

Croutons offer another simple solution, turning leftover bread into a functional ingredient rather than a source of waste. Tossed in olive oil and baked until golden, they add a rustic charm and a satisfying bite that anchors the lighter ingredients. This interplay of soft and crisp creates a dynamic eating experience that feels complex yet entirely approachable.

Mediterranean Inspiration

The Mediterranean diet is practically the blueprint for healthy warm-weather eating. Drawing from this cuisine means embracing ingredients like olives, artichokes, and feta cheese. A pasta puttanesca, with its bold combination of olives, capers, and anchovies, delivers an intense flavor punch that feels both salty and satisfying without being heavy.

Another excellent choice is a pasta with grilled vegetables and a yogurt-based dressing. The smoky char of the vegetables pairs beautifully with the cool tang of yogurt, creating a balance that is both hearty and refreshing. This approach highlights the natural flavors of the produce while keeping the overall profile light and suitable for hot days.

Asian-Inspired Twists

Asian flavors offer a fantastic alternative for those looking to move away from traditional tomato or olive oil bases. A sesame-ginger dressing provides a warm, nutty aroma that is incredibly soothing yet vibrant. Pairing this with crisp vegetables like bell peppers and snap peas results in a dish that is texturally exciting and visually stunning.

Chili oil or paste can be added to taste for those who enjoy a little heat. It adds a layer of complexity that wakes up the senses without making the dish feel heavy in the summer heat. The combination of nuttiness, spice, and fresh vegetables creates a pasta experience that is distinctly different but equally delightful.
